Position: Caretaker

Grade D2: Salary: £18, 933 - £21, 748 per annum pro rata

Hours: 37 hrs per week, 52 weeks a year

The hours of working will split into two shifts that include the opening and closing of the school (this is negotiable).

We are seeking to appoint a Caretaker to join our hard-working team at St Mary’s Catholic Primary.

St Mary's is a successful and happy school, combining a caring Catholic ethos with enthusiastic learners.  Children's behaviour is outstanding due to our commitment to high expectations and a positive approach to learning.

Duties will include site security; health and safety of the premises and grounds; some cleaning and some decorating; minor repairs and maintenance, and some lifting and furniture moving.

There may be over-time hours to cover any activities the school has outside of the working hours for the post.  Experience is preferred but not essential.
